The Executioner Set is a heavy armor set in Dark Souls III.

In-Game Description

Steel armor of Horace the Hushed, who took a liking to its cold, bulky insides.
The original owner was said to be a corrupt executioner, who was killed and stripped of his armor.
Horace is one of only two children to escape Aldrich's clutches.

Availability[]

Purchased from the Shrine Handmaid for a total of 18,000 souls after Horace the Hushed is killed.

Characteristics[]

Weighing in at the upper end of heavy armor sets, the Executioner Set provides good defenses as a cost of its weight.

It is extremely resilient against most forms of physical damage, only being weak to Strike damage like most other plate metal sets. It has very good elemental resistances as well, being weak only to Lightning damage, and having higher than usual resistance to Fire damage. It also resists status effects very effectively, only truly being "weak" to Curse buildup.

With a heavy weight and good poise-to-weight ratio, the Executioner Set can reliably wield heavy weapons to trade against enemies, provided that the proper amount of Vitality is invested.

Trivia[]

  • The armor appears to be a reference to the armor worn by Bazuso in Berserk, with the helmet being especially similar to the helmet worn by him.
